Description from the seller

Abstract avant-garde composition created in 1930s by American artist Charles Bert (born 1873 Milwaukee - died in Lyme, Connecticut, USA). Pupil of Cincinnati Art Gall. , Art League in New York and Academy Julian in Paris. Similar kompositon by Bert was sold by Dobiaschofsky Auctionhouse (Switzerland) on 5.11.1999, Lot 345.

Literature: Hans Vollmer "Artist Lexicon of 20 century"(in german), Seemann, Leipzig, 1953

Provenance : French private collection.

Inscription: signed Bert lower right.

Technique: Gouache on card board, unframed.

Measurements: w 7 7/8" x h 11 4/5" (20,8 x 30,2 cm)

Condition: fair original condition, wear consistent with age and use.
